The implementation of a 40°C constant temperature drying phase is a critical technical requirement in the manufacturing of Black Pepper transdermal patches to ensure structural integrity and therapeutic potency. This precise thermal treatment facilitates the controlled evaporation of solvents and moisture, preventing physical defects like bubbling or cracking while protecting heat-sensitive bioactive compounds from degradation.
This specialized drying process is the cornerstone of high-standard transdermal manufacturing, ensuring that every patch delivers consistent drug distribution, optimal adhesion, and long-term stability for global distribution.
Optimizing Physical Matrix Integrity
Preventing Surface Defects and Crusting
Rapid temperature spikes during the drying process can cause the surface of a transdermal patch to "skin over" or crust prematurely. By maintaining a constant 40°C environment, moisture and residual solvents evaporate slowly and uniformly from the bottom up. This prevents the formation of surface bubbles, wrinkles, or matrix cracking that would otherwise compromise the patch's professional appearance and functionality.
Ensuring Uniform Thickness and Flexibility
Consistency is paramount for brand owners who require precise dosing across millions of units. A stable thermal environment ensures the polymer matrix settles into a uniform thickness with the necessary flexibility. This structural density is essential for precision cutting during the final stages of manufacturing, ensuring each unit meets exact specifications.
Preserving Bioactive Potency and Safety
Protecting Heat-Sensitive Compounds
Black Pepper extracts contain volatile and heat-sensitive bioactive components that can degrade if exposed to excessive heat. Utilizing a mild 40°C threshold accelerates solvent removal without triggering thermal degradation. This ensures that the therapeutic efficacy of the patch remains intact throughout its shelf life, a critical factor for B2B partners focused on product performance.
Minimizing Residual Solvents and Irritation
Effective removal of organic solvents—such as ethanol or acetone—is a non-negotiable safety requirement. The extended treatment period at 40°C ensures these solvents are reduced to trace levels, significantly lowering the risk of skin irritation for the end-user. This adherence to safety protocols is vital for maintaining GMP compliance and passing rigorous international quality audits.
Engineering Long-Term Stability
Managing Moisture for Microbial Resistance
The primary reference indicates that precise drying keeps the final moisture content within the ideal range of 1% to 10%. This specific window is crucial for preventing the growth of microbes during storage. By controlling this variable, manufacturers can guarantee physical stability and a longer shelf life, which is essential for large-scale distribution and warehousing.
Preventing Thermal Stress Deformation
Sudden cooling or heating can cause internal stress within the film layers, leading to "curling" or loss of adhesion. A constant temperature oven provides the stable thermal energy needed to form a dense, structurally sound polymer network. This results in a patch that adheres reliably to the skin, providing a consistent release profile for the active ingredients.
Understanding the Manufacturing Trade-offs
Time Efficiency vs. Quality Assurance
The 48-hour drying window represents a significant investment in time and energy compared to flash-drying methods. However, rapid drying often leads to "solvent trapping," where liquid is locked beneath a hardened surface layer, resulting in unstable patches. Professional OEM partners prioritize this extended curing time to ensure the product does not fail during long-term storage or under varying climate conditions.
